From vitamin D to melatonin: here are our allies against Covid-19

by admin

The “chemistry” may not be the only key to countering and fighting the virus Sars-CoV-2. Parallel to the development of drugs and vaccines in laboratories, in fact, scientific journals continue to publish an increasingly substantial body of studies that indicate a new, more “natural” path. A path that is in some ways easier, in the absence of direct side effects, but also more insidious considering the multitude of commercial interests at stake.

But to the test of science vitamin D, omega-3, lactoferrin, quercetin, vitamin C, zinc, melatonin and glutathione, and activators of sirtuins such as the synergy between pterostilbene, polytadine and onochiol, it seems they can play a decisive role both in the prevention of infection Covid-19 than in contrasting any complications. To clarify the jungle of studies conducted on these compounds and molecules, it was David Della Morte Canosci, professor of Neurology at the University of Miami, of Internal Medicine at the Tor Vergata University of Rome and at the San Raffaele University of Rome.

In a study published in the journal International Journal of Molecular Sciences and commissioned by Sirt500, the scientist conducted an analysis of all the research on the subject present in the scientific literature. “We decided to investigate the possible antiviral and metabolic effects of these compounds in order to propose a combination of them for potential applications in the prevention and treatment of Covid-19”, He explains Of Death Canosci. “These compounds could be very useful for people who have impaired immune responses, such as people with diabetes mellitus, who we know are more at risk for complications,” he adds.

Finding the right balance between the substances investigated would have two effects: prevention of contagion and mitigation of the effects of the infection. “From our integrated analysis, evaluating the numerous published studies, the strength of the vitamin D and omega-3s in countering the inflammatory process triggered by the infection, reducing the cytokine storm typical of Covid-19”, He explains Of Death Canosci.

“The activators of sirtuins, such as pterostilbene, polydatin and onochiol, on the other hand seem to have a very powerful antiviral action: through a direct regulation of ACE2 receptors, the gateway Sars-CoV-2 in the cell, they inhibit virus replication, ”he adds. Not only. “These compounds, through the activation of sirtuins, in addition to antagonizing the action of the virus on ACE2 receptors, have a strong antioxidant, anti-inflammatory and anticoagulant power. This would reduce the chances of infection Covid-19 cause that multisystemic pathogenic action such as the lethal formation of microemboli ”. While zinc, vitamin C and melatonin would be able to strengthen the immune system. “This is very important especially for immunosuppressed patients or patients with chronic diseases”.
